ICSE Class 7 English Exam Overview: Syllabus, Sample Papers, and More

ICSE Class 7 English follows a balanced approach by focusing on strengthening language skills in reading, writing, grammar, and vocabulary. Students at this stage move beyond basic comprehension and develop advanced skills like inference, creative writing, textual interpretation, and precise grammatical usage.

English in Class 7 forms an essential foundation for higher classes, especially for the application-heavy English curriculum in ICSE Classes 9 and 10. Although exams are conducted internally by each school, the syllabus and pattern closely follow CISCE guidelines for English Language and English Literature.

1.0ICSE Class 7 English Exam Structure

The Exam structure/pattern for ICSE Class 7 are set by the respective schools and most follow the 80:20 pattern, where 80 marks are for theory and 20 marks for internal assessment.

Particulars

Details

Conducting Body

Individual Schools (following CISCE curriculum)

Total Marks

100 Marks

Theory Paper Weightage (Summative)

80 Marks (2 to 2.5 hours)

Internal Assessment (Formative)

20 Marks (Assignments, Projects, Tests)

Exam Sections

Language Paper + Literature Component

Passing Criteria

Minimum 33%–35% overall (Theory + Internal)

2.0ICSE Class 7 English Syllabus: Core Divisions

The ICSE Class 7 English syllabus is typically divided into:

  • English Language – Grammar, composition, comprehension, vocabulary
  • English Literature – Prose, Poetry, and Drama (as per school-selected readers)

Part A: English Language (Grammar & Writing Skills)

Grammar

Covers essential rules required for accurate writing and speaking.

Key Topics:

  • Parts of Speech
  • Tenses and their correct usage
  • Active & Passive Voice
  • Direct & Indirect Speech
  • Prepositions, Conjunctions, Articles
  • Subject–Verb Agreement
  • Degrees of Comparison
  • Phrasal Verbs & Idioms
  • Simple & Compound Sentences

Composition (Creative & Functional Writing)

Students learn structured, imaginative, and purpose-driven writing.

Types of Writing Covered:

  • Paragraph Writing
  • Essay Writing (descriptive, narrative, imaginative)
  • Picture-Based Composition
  • Notice Writing
  • Message Writing
  • Diary Entry
  • Letter Writing (informal + basic formal)
  • Story Completion

Comprehension (Unseen Passage)

Includes:

  • Prose passages
  • Short poems (school-dependent)

Skills Tested:

  • Identifying key ideas
  • Inference and analysis
  • Vocabulary usage
  • Summarising and extracting information

Part B: English Literature (Prose, Poetry & Drama)

Most ICSE Class 7 schools use readers such as:

  • Treasure Chest (Prose & Poetry – Selina)
  • A school-selected play or short drama text

Prose

May include short stories, moral narratives, biographies, adventure tales, or historical fiction.

These develop skills like:

  • Understanding plot, theme, character
  • Identifying moral lessons
  • Interpreting author’s perspective
  • Writing textual answers

Poetry

Includes descriptive, narrative, and lyrical poems appropriate for middle school.

Skills Developed:

  • Poetic devices (simile, metaphor, alliteration)
  • Understanding tone and imagery
  • Explanation of verses
  • Appreciation questions

3.0ICSE Class 7 English Exam Pattern

Most schools structure the exam as:

Section A: English Language (40 Marks)

Includes:

  • Unseen Comprehension: Grammar (MCQs, gap-filling, editing, jumbled sentences)
  • Composition (paragraph/essay/picture-based)
  • Letter or Notice writing

Goal: Test linguistic accuracy, clarity, and fluency.

Section B: English Literature (40 Marks)

Includes:

  • Extract-based questions (Prose/Poetry)
  • Long answers on characters, themes, events
  • Short notes
  • Poem explanation
  • Drama questions (if part of the reader)

Goal: Evaluate comprehension, interpretation, and ability to support answers with textual evidence.

4.0ICSE Class 7 English Internal Assessment

Internal Assessment encourages creativity, reading habits, and spoken English.

Component

Description

Class Tests

Periodic grammar/literature tests

Project Work

Creative writing project, book review, poem analysis

Oral Skills

Recitation, storytelling, speeches

Listening Tasks

Teacher-read passages followed by Q&A

Notebook Work

Neatness, organisation, regular submission

6.0ICSE Class 7 English Preparation Strategy

1. Improve Grammar Basics: Practise tenses, articles, prepositions, and voice regularly.

2. Read Daily: Enhances comprehension, vocabulary, and writing flow.

3. Practise Composition Formats: Letter writing, notices, and diary entries must follow correct structure.

4. Use Text Quotes in Answers: In literature answers, quoting short phrases from the text helps score better.

5. Attempt Sample Papers: Builds time management and writing speed.
